Collaborative Journalism – mining the community to ensure all voices are heard
Citizen journalism has become a defining force in how information travels. Smartphones, social platforms, and community networks allow ordinary people to document events in real time. At the same time, traditional media increasingly collaborates with audiences, using shared editorial content to expand coverage and diversify perspectives. While it is beneficial for newsrooms to have a wider reach with more diverse voices, providing access to real-time information and building a stronger community trust, there are some risks and ethical considerations. This session explores how these two worlds intersect—and how to do it responsibly.
